ACWA eNews for Aug. 27, 2014 in ACWA eNews   Senate Approves Groundwater Legislation Submitted by Lisa Lien-Mager on Wed, 08/27/2014 – 7:08pm Legislation aimed at advancing sustainable management of the state’s groundwater basins passed on the Senate floor late Wednesday afternoon. AB 1739 by Assembly Member Roger Dickinson (D-Sacramento) passed on a 26-11 vote […]

Water policy debate in California is never just “fish vs. farmers” 08/25/2014 Author: Nicola Overstreet The San Francisco Bay-Delta Estuary is the largest estuary on the west coast of the Americas. It’s also one of the largest points of contention in California’s ongoing struggle to allocate its supply of water. Often, the debate over how […]
